Hi all,
So try and keep this as short and sweet as poss. A friend and I are looking at getting a flat in the East Sussex area. We've seen some really nice properties in the area at about £700 per month.
Now this is where i need a bit of advice... So at £350 a month each on rent, what other costs would we be likely to be looking at?

also on job wise, to make this a success what sort of monthly wage would be enough to live on after having paid rent, bills, phone, shopping, petrol etc...

can only tell you what we pay for bills really

Gas - £50 p/m
Ele - £50 p/m
Council Tax - £150ish
Water - £10
TV License - £136
Sky (tv/bb/phone) - £48.50
BT Line rental - £30 per quarter
